Question | Answer |
what evidence did Wegener find for Pangaea? | he found evidence from land features, fossils, and climate. |
why was Wegener's hypothesis rejected? | because he could not give a satisfactory for "why." (the force that pushes or pulls the continents. |
what are mid-ocean ridges? | long chains of mountains that rise up from the ocean floor. |
what is sea-floor spreading? | sea-floor spreading adds more crust to the ocean floor. At the same time, older strips of rocks move outward from either side of the ridge. |
what is evidence of sea-floor spreading? | evidence from ocean material (molten material), evidence from magnetic stripes, and evidence from drilling samples. |
what happens at deep-ocean trenches? | the oceanic crust bends backward. in a process taking tens of millions of years, part of the ocean floor sinks back into the mantle at deep-ocean trenches. |
what is subduction? | the process by which the ocean floor sinks beneath a deep-ocean trench and back into the mantle again. |
what is the theory of plate tectonics? | the theory of plate tectonics states that Earth's plates are in slow, constant motion, driven by convection currents in the mantle. |
